Fire Tears Through Luxury Flat on Thurloe Square
Firefighters were scrambled in force to tackle a blaze at a high-value flat on Thurloe Square, London, on Wednesday night. The property, last sold for a staggering £11.8 million, went up in flames just after 9pm.
Emergency Services Shut Down Roads and Reroute Buses
The Met Police swiftly closed the road in both directions, forcing bus services in the area onto diversion routes. Traffic chaos ensued as crews battled the inferno.
Seventy Firefighters Battle the Blaze with Southern Water Aid
Ten fire engines and seventy firefighters descended on the scene. Support from Southern Water was brought in to ramp up water pressure, helping firefighters get control of the flames.
Lucky Escape as No Injuries Are Reported
Thankfully, there have been no reports of injuries despite the scale of the fire. The flat, recently sold for nearly £12 million, suffered significant damage as crews worked into the night to douse the flames.
